Производительность EF Core 2.1 для таблицы с 40 или более столбцами - PullRequest
0 голосов
/ 28 сентября 2018

У меня есть база данных SQL 2014, к которой я пытаюсь получить доступ с помощью Entity Framework Core 2.1.Многие из таблиц имеют более 40 столбцов.Я использовал EF Core Power Tools для генерации классов модели и контекста, и псевдонимы не используются.Когда я получаю данные из таблицы только для одной записи через API, это занимает более 15 секунд.Если я удаляю все свойства, кроме 10, это займет меньше секунды.Проблема в том, что мне нужны все столбцы в таблице, но 15 секунд недопустимо.Почему при доступе ко всем столбцам происходит такое снижение производительности?

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...